Tips for Starting a Franchise Business in Oklahoma

  • Franchise fees range from $10K to $100K+ depending on the brand. That's before buildout, equipment, or working capital. Read the FDD (Franchise Disclosure Document) line by line.
  • Royalties run 4-8% of gross revenue. Every month. Forever. That's gross, not net. Factor this into your break-even math from day one.
  • Talk to at least 10 existing franchisees before signing. The FDD lists every current and former franchisee. Call the ones who left. They'll be honest.
  • Territory protection matters. Some franchises let other franchisees open 2 miles away. Verify your exclusive territory in writing.
